93 Wagon, 4cyl, burping
 
Hi there. Looking for some diagnostic help. I have a 93 Camry Wagon, 4 cylinder. 96,000 miles. One problem I have, but I don't know if it's related, is that I have a small leak in the head gasket, so the 4th spark plug sits in oil sometime; meanwhile, I get occasional blue smoke on start-up, so I'm thinking those are related.

Hopefully unrelated is the fact that, yesterday, the car began burping/hesitating. It does it most while accelerating in low gears. It's worse with the air on. When stopped, but in drive, it idles lower than usual and stutters a bit. In park, it's not as bad. Turn the air off and put in park, and it's barely detectable. Based on my limited knowledge, it seems like a fuel supply issue, but I could be way off. This just started yesterday (it wasn't gradual), and I had earlier gotten gas from a crummy gas station, so not sure if that's related.

Any thoughts?

The low idle/hesitation could be leaking HG and bad compression in related cylinder. I don't think you can properly diagnose until the HG is fixed. The miles are fairly low so it may pay you to fix this. You can try cleaning the idle air control valve which may inprove the idle. Shuting off the A/C and putting in park/neutral reduces drag so engine idle should improve. I would do a complete compression test to see if fixing would be worth it.

Thanks for the input, Pedro. Turns out all it needed was a new distributor cap and rotor, and I swapped out ignition wires while I was at it. Runs like new again!
